C#窗体控件详解:列表视图与控件操作

需积分: 0 3 下载量 164 浏览量 更新于2024-07-13 收藏 176KB PPT 举报
"本文主要介绍了C#中列表视图(ListView)控件的使用,以及控件在窗体设计中的操作方法。ListView控件比列表框功能更加强大,能够以大图标、小图标、列表和详细信息四种模式展示列表项。文章还涉及了窗体控件的编程基础,包括如何添加、调整控件,控件的分类,以及使用快捷访问键和容器控件的概念。" 在C#开发中,ListView控件是一个常用且功能强大的控件,它能够以多种方式展示数据,如大图标、小图标、列表和详细信息模式。这种灵活性使得ListView适用于各种不同的应用场景,如文件浏览器、数据库查看器等。ListView控件不仅允许用户浏览数据,还可以支持排序、选择和自定义列显示,提供了丰富的功能接口供开发者使用。 在窗体设计中,开发者可以通过Visual Studio的窗体设计器向窗体添加控件。有三种常见的添加控件的方法:双击工具箱中的控件、拖放控件至窗体指定位置,以及使用代码动态创建控件。例如,创建一个新的按钮控件btnNew的代码是`Button btnNew = new Button();`。 控件分为两类:具有用户界面的控件,如按钮、文本框,它们在运行时可见;没有用户界面的控件,如定时器、背景工作者,它们在后台运行,运行时不可见。在窗体设计器中,无界面控件通常出现在窗体下方的窗格里。 此外,开发者还可以利用控件的Text属性设置快捷访问键。例如,将按钮btnNew的Text属性设置为“新建(&N)”后,用户可以通过按Alt+N快捷键直接触发Click事件。需要注意的是,若要显示文本中的与号,需要使用"&&"。 窗体本身作为容器控件,可以包含其他控件。容器控件还包括分组框和面板等,这些控件的Controls属性保存了它们内部的所有子控件。调整控件的位置和大小,可以通过“格式”菜单、快捷菜单或工具栏的按钮来实现,可以批量对齐和调整多个选定的控件。 ListView控件是C#中处理列表数据的强大工具,而窗体设计则涉及到控件的添加、调整以及它们的交互方式,这些都是C#开发中的基本技能。熟练掌握这些知识,能够帮助开发者构建更加高效、用户友好的应用程序。